Oooh, here are my recommendations and my opinions for the good one's I've read:

The ones you read just for expirience

Cupcakes - The most horrible gore story. Everything about this story is atrocious, and it's not a good story at all. You just read it to know about it.

Rainbow Factory - A Grim Dark story about how rainbows are made. The writing was good, and the story was fantastic idea. Beware though, this is nothing for the weak. You've been warned.

The really good ones

My Little Dashie - The saddest story I've ever read in my life. Absolutely worth reading this.

Allegrezza - Written by a fellow forum member here, he has hilarious humor and excellent writing skills. Vinyl Scratch and Octavia, two ponies with opposite personalites and behaviours, are lead together in a romantic story.

Anthropology - In my opinion a very unique concept for a story. Lyra is obsessed with humans and tries to prove they exist, however nopony listens to her. This makes her even more determined to find proof that humans once existed, and even goes as far as to make herself a set of human hands.

Antipodes - Luna and Celestia vanished a long time ago, leaving the sun and moon frozen.

Romance Reports - This story contains CLOP. If you don't know what that is, google it. Why is this on my list? Because it relates to real life in so many ways, and was one of the most gripping stories I've read. The scenes are very "saucy", but the writing is brilliant. It's a must-read.

Fallout Equestria - One of the longest fan fictions ever written. If you can buy the unrealism of an untrained young pony killing heavily armed raiders, the rest of the story is brilliant. I haven't read it all to be honest, but being 200 pages in I can safely say it's a good read.

Happy reading! And don't be afraid to cry when you read My Little Dashie. We all did.
